1 obsolete : to make a denial
2 : REVOKE
3 : to go back on a promise or commitment -
In some card games, such as whisks, withholding a card of the current suit. In other words, when the pile is hearts you must play a heart if you have one, when the pile is spades you must play a spade etc. Reneging is when you break this rule by playing a different card. This results in losing 2 tricks or automatically losing the game.
